S1223 (2025) NIE Networks Dynamic Line Rating
Notice Description
NIE Networks wishes to appoint a Contractor to develop, supply, deliver to site, site testing and commission a remote monitoring and data acquisition system. The project will support NIE Networks and System Operator Northern Ireland (SONI) in calculating the rating of 110 kV overhead lines (OHLs) in Northern Ireland, taking account of the cooling effects attributable to local weather conditions.

Options: The Contracting Entity intends to establish a Framework Agreement for a period of four (4) years, with the option, (entirely at the discretion of NIE Networks) to extend by up two further periods of two (2) years (eight (8) years in total).
